'I had my doubts over whether to carry on'' - Mendy opens up on year out of football and pressures of being Chelsea goalkeeper

Edouard Mendy has revealed he had "doubts over whether to carry on" after taking a year out of football in France and insisted that he is well "aware" of the pressures that come with being a Chelsea goalkeeper.

Mendy has endured a challenging journey to the top of his profession since beginning his career at Cherbourg in 2011.

The Senegalese 'keeper spent three seasons with the third-division French outfit before being released at the end of his contract, and spent the next 12 months contemplating his future.
